I123-FP-CIT 单光子发射断层扫描在长期混合震颤患者中的应用。

I123-FP-CIT single-photon emission tomography in patients with long-standing mixed tremor.

机构信息

Department of Neurology, CHU Caremeau, Nimes, France.

出版信息

Eur J Neurol. 2013 Feb;20(2):382-8. doi: 10.1111/j.1468-1331.2012.03875.x. Epub 2012 Oct 8.

DOI:10.1111/j.1468-1331.2012.03875.x
PMID:23043318
Abstract

BACKGROUND AND PURPOSE

Essential tremor is an abnormal movement characterized by postural and/or kinetic tremor. In some essential tremor patients, rest tremor (RT) is observed but it is not clear if this RT is a feature of essential tremor or a symptom of Parkinson's disease (PD). I123-FP-CIT single-photon emission tomography is used to distinguish essential tremor and PD.

OBJECTIVES

To analyse I123-FP-CIT single-photon emission tomography in a larger series of patients with mixed tremor (i.e. action tremor associated with RT) without PD criteria.

METHODS

We studied 33 consecutives patients (18 men and 15 women) with mixed tremor, clinically and by neuroimaging in all cases.

RESULTS

I123-FP-CIT single-photon emission tomography was abnormal in 25 of our patients (75.7%) with mixed tremor, and we noted a reduced uptake mostly in the putamen. In our patients with abnormal imaging, RT was unilateral in 52%. In 15 of these 25 patients, putaminal reduced uptake was bilateral and symmetrical. In the other 10 patients, putaminal reduced uptake was asymmetrical or unilateral. In these 10 cases, six had a unilateral RT corresponding to (crossed) predominant reduced uptake in three cases. In our patients with normal imaging, RT was unilateral in 87.5%.

CONCLUSIONS

This study shows that mixed tremor is a heterogeneous entity. The majority of patients with mixed tremor showed nigrostriatal dysfunction on I123-FP-CIT single-photon emission tomography, suggesting that mixed tremor may be a parkinsonian syndrome rather than a clinical variant of essential tremor.

摘要

背景与目的

特发性震颤是一种以姿势性和/或运动性震颤为特征的异常运动。在一些特发性震颤患者中,会观察到静止性震颤(RT),但目前尚不清楚这种 RT 是特发性震颤的特征还是帕金森病(PD)的症状。I123-FP-CIT 单光子发射断层扫描用于区分特发性震颤和 PD。

目的

分析更大系列的、无 PD 标准的混合性震颤(即与 RT 相关的动作性震颤)患者的 I123-FP-CIT 单光子发射断层扫描结果。

方法

我们研究了 33 例连续的混合性震颤患者(18 名男性和 15 名女性),所有患者均进行了临床和神经影像学检查。

结果

我们的 33 例混合性震颤患者中,25 例(75.7%)I123-FP-CIT 单光子发射断层扫描异常,我们注意到纹状体摄取减少,主要是在壳核。在影像学异常的患者中,52%的 RT 为单侧。在这 25 例患者中,15 例壳核摄取减少是双侧对称的。在另外 10 例患者中,壳核摄取减少是不对称或单侧的。在这 10 例患者中,有 6 例单侧 RT 对应于(交叉)优势减少摄取,在 3 例患者中。在影像学正常的患者中,87.5%的 RT 为单侧。

结论

本研究表明混合性震颤是一种异质性实体。大多数混合性震颤患者的 I123-FP-CIT 单光子发射断层扫描显示黑质纹状体功能障碍,提示混合性震颤可能是帕金森综合征,而不是特发性震颤的临床变异。
